Thanks!  I have the older Contender and Prodry Goretex jackets.  They are incredible as far as being waterproof and windproof.  I've handled the Challenger series at the Field and Stream store and thought it was pretty nice.  The jackets I have are more of a hard shell and the Challenger fabric is a little softer in feel.  I honestly don't think the Challenger would hold up to constant, torrential rain, but I imagine it would be pretty good.  I think what makes me skeptical is the fact that it's only 2-layer fabric.  For what it's worth, I have a buddy in NY that has the set and swears by it.

After years of Frogg Toggs and the insides of both pants and jackets tearing out,  I went with Frabill.  I love the reticulated knees.

 

Are they keeping me dry?  I think so.  I sweat when I move around when it's even 60 degrees outside.  I put on a rainsuit and I am SOAKED in sweat when I take it off.  Its better than being rained on and drenched I guess.
